Fox Experts: This can't be prevented

Here's Fox News with a piece about campus security.

The unprecedented school massacre at Virginia Tech has underscored one terrifying fact: Such attacks can never be completely prevented, and college campuses are especially vulnerable.


The experts argue that while campus security isn't entirely achievable (I agree in that there's nothing stopping a person who's genuinely bonkers) it's still possible for campuses to take stricter preventative measures such as:

  • Marksmanship training of campus police officers
  • bagchecks at campus events
  • more campus police officers
  • ID scanners in classrooms and dorms
  • metal detectors in classrooms and dorms
  • security cameras
Could this be the first call for what results in you having to empty your pockets before going to a school football game? Well, anyone who would take the Fox Experts argument has a little more ammo because of the woeful campus response to the shootings.
